阿里云服务器搭建个人网站

article/2025/9/27 1:14:14

文章目录

  • 一、事先准备
      • 1、购买阿里云服务器
      • 2、购买域名,并进行备案
  • 二、服务器的基本使用
      • 1、服务器配置
      • 2、远程连接
  • 三、服务器的高级使用
      • 1、安装宝塔面板
      • 2、部署网站
      • 3、固定链接的设置
      • 4、为网站部署SSL证书(重点)

一、事先准备

1、购买阿里云服务器

https://www.aliyun.com/activity/new?utm_content=se_1011325363
在这里插入图片描述

image-20220218122732295

2、购买域名,并进行备案

https://wanwang.aliyun.com/

过程比较漫长,大概需要一个月左右

二、服务器的基本使用

1、服务器配置

  • 控制台查看购买的服务器

image-20220218124458436

  • 设置服务器密码

image-20220218124932498

2、远程连接

1、Workbench远程连接

网页版远程连接,支持复制粘贴.

image-20220218130307068

2、VNC远程连接(少用)

无法直接复制粘贴,需要通过命令框进行复制命令

image-20220218130825016

3、发送远程命令(云助手)

无需远程连接登录实例,即可完成查看硬盘空间、安装软件、启动停止服务等操作

image-20220218131046515

4、XSheel远程连接(常用)

image-20220218134011604

5、使用SSH秘钥对进行远程登录

参考文档: https://help.aliyun.com/document_detail/51798.html

  • 创建秘钥对

image-20220218162127340

  • 被自动下载的私钥

image-20220218162249553

  • 绑定秘钥对:

image-20220218163401366

image-20220218163453177

  • 下载MobaXterm

官网: https://mobaxterm.mobatek.net

image-20220218171104274

image-20220218170932104

  • 进行连接

image-20220218172802451

  • 补充:使用阿里云网站自带的shell终端进行远程连接:

image-20220218165812481

三、服务器的高级使用

1、安装宝塔面板

参考地址: https://www.kubk.net/835.html

  • 进行安装 (以Centos7.8为例)
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h

image-20220218132114262

  • 进行登录

使用外网面板登录宝塔面板,弹出 你正在以游客方式浏览

解决方案:在安全组中开放8888端口

image-20220218132734286

image-20220218132816423

2、部署网站

1、域名解析

进入域名页面, 点击域名解析设置,进行新手引导,添加对应的实例公网IP

image-20220218174400026

image-20220218174531616

image-20220218174122426

image-20220218174915217

2、网站部署

image-20220218200658736

Snipaste_2022-02-18_18-36-29

Snipaste_2022-02-18_18-38-04

3、网站安装

image-20220218184517751

image-20220218184659716

image-20220218185010988

4、网站登录

image-20220218185134952

5、网站的访问测试

第一次不能访问,解决办法安全组中开启80端口

开启后:

image-20220218190147648

6、为网站添加非www开头的域名.

image-20220218190316507

image-20220218190419880

3、固定链接的设置

1、默认连接:http://www.szdalizi.top/index.php/2022/02/18/hello-world/ 域名+年月日+文字题目

image-20220218191655697

image-20220218191517414

2、将WordPress设置为 伪静态

image-20220218192044730

image-20220218191924529

3、固定连接设置

image-20220218192342994

4、查看效果:已修改为伪静态页面.

image-20220218192450609

4、为网站部署SSL证书(重点)

1、进入阿里云,申请免费的SSL证书(免费的)

image-20220218193157250

2、进行证书下载

image-20220218193428433

image-20220218194052949

3、进行部署

image-20220218194332284

image-20220218194420109
4、开启443端口

image-20220218195030814

5、部署成功

image-20220218195129975

至此,我的第一个网站 https://www.szdalizi.top/ ,就诞生了。

如果有收获!!! 希望老铁们来个三连,点赞、收藏、转发。
创作不易,别忘点个赞,可以让更多的人看到这篇文章,顺便鼓励我写出更好的博客


http://chatgpt.dhexx.cn/article/0HWJ3dCv.shtml

相关文章

服务器搭建个人网站(阿里云服务器)

服务器搭建个人网站 一丶购买服务器 这里我选的是阿里云服务器,进入阿里云官网阿里云-上云就上阿里云 阿里云提供了几种服务器,云服务器ESC、轻量应用服务器,ESC更好一点儿,我选了轻量级应用服务器。购买好了之后,在…

搭建个人服务器

组建一个自己的服务器 一、服务器是什么?他的作用是什么?二、服务的分类!三、域名是什么? 相信学习了一段时间的网页以后,都想自己做一个网站,体验一哈当站长的感觉,这里小佬弟今天就教大家搭建…

手把手教你搭建一台永久运行的个人服务器

No.1 树莓派是什么? 1. 用我的话理解2. 市面上的型号3. 树莓派 zero w4. 更多树莓派No.2 树莓派zero w安装系统 1. 准备2. 第一步下载系统镜像3. 使用 Win32DiskImager 往内存卡中写入镜像4. 修改 boot 分区的文件5. 组装我们的最小主机并连接6. 优化咱们树莓派的系…

个人服务器的选择

相信有很多小码农在学习技术和平时写Demo的时候,都需要一台个人服务器来看看效果。这里我就简单介绍一下如何去选择适合自己的服务器。 首先需求和用途: 主要考察空间大小 / 流量 / 连接数 / 数据库 / 流量 / 是否有其它特殊用途等。 如果你对服务器性能…

微信小程序获得二维码

网上找了一些方法,基本都是获得appid和access_token通过访问对应网站获得,这里介绍一种新方法,是微信小程序网站自带的,操作如下 登录微信小程序点击设置即可看到对应生成的小程序二维码 点击下载还可以根据需求下载对应大小甚至添…

微信小程序普通二维码解析

1、区别于微信小程序官方二维码是直接从onLoad的 options 解构出来就行,它是一个对象,这个大家都知道。 2、普通二维码 也是从onLoad的 options 里解构出来,此时options里应该只有一个参数就是scene, 但是scene里的参数是被编码过的&#x…

扫普通二维码进入小程序、链接进入小程序

目录 一、扫普通二维码进入小程序 1、扫码进入小程序管理页 2、点击开发管理-开发设置-扫普通链接二维码打开小程序-添加 3. 完善配置内容 二. 前端获取参数 三.开发本地调试 一、扫普通二维码进入小程序 1、扫码进入小程序管理页 2、点击开发管理-开发设置-扫普通链接二维…

微信小程序生成带参二维码——并通过扫码获取二维码的参数

注意:保证当前小程序要有线上版本 通过url拼接参数。http://***.com?id123 这种方式要利用一个插件(GitHub - adventurewithme/chajian: 用到的各种插件里面的qrcode.js)。 要转换的这个url必须要在微信公众平台配置了扫普通链接二维码打…

微信小程序扫描二维码

点击按钮扫描二维码 <button classdeaBtn bindtapscancode>扫描二维码</button> scancode: function(){// 允许从相机和相册扫码wx.scanCode({success(res) {console.log(res);wx.showToast({title: 成功,icon: success,duration: 2000})},fail: (res) >{cons…

微信扫描普通二维码进入小程序

微信扫描普通二维码进入小程序的方法&#xff0c;和代码没有什么关系&#xff0c;主要是在小程序平台进行设置 1. 开发配置 开发 —— 开发管理 —— 开发设置 —— 扫普通链接二维码打开小程序 2. 配置规则 根据说明配置内容就行&#xff0c;后面有说带参数的配置和怎么在小…

微信小程序使用weapp-qrcode生成二维码

<canvas style"width:108rpx;height:108rpx; canvas-idqrcode></canvas>// weapp-qrcode.js在最后面 const QR require(../../utils/weapp-qrcode.js); // 生成二维码createQrcode(qrCodeLink) {var imgData QR.drawImg(qrCodeLink, {typeNumber: 4, …

微信小程序----获取二维码

WXRUI体验二维码 如果文章对你有帮助的话&#xff0c;请打开微信扫一下二维码&#xff0c;点击一下广告&#xff0c;支持一下作者&#xff01;谢谢&#xff01; 前言&#xff1a;随着小程序的火爆&#xff0c;功能的越发完善&#xff0c;客户的需求越来越多&#xff0c;终于在此…

微信小程序如何生成当前页面二维码

码字不易&#xff0c;有帮助的同学希望能关注一下我的微信公众号&#xff1a;Code程序人生&#xff0c;感谢&#xff01;代码自用自取。 在微信小程序的开发中&#xff0c;很多的业务场景下都会有生成二维码&#xff0c;然后通过扫码二维码&#xff0c;进入指定页面的需求。 我…

微信小程序–二维码生成器

在微信小程序联盟上有一个小练习&#xff0c;是要实现小程序上的二维码生成器&#xff0c;想想基于jquery的二维码生成插件有很多&#xff0c;但是小程序是不允许操作dom的&#xff0c;所以自己找了一个纯javascript版的二维码生成源码&#xff0c;然后换汤不换药把其中的hmtl5…

微信小程序怎样生成体验版二维码?微信小程序怎么转化为二维码?

1.首先要把代码上传到微信公众平台 方法&#xff1a;在微信开发者工具界面&#xff0c;右上角&#xff0c;点击上传&#xff0c;如果提示成功&#xff0c;说明已经上传成功。 2.登录微信公众号平台&#xff08;微信公众号和微信小程序都是使用这个网站登陆的&#xff09; 网址…

微信小程序识别二维码

微信小程序二维码识别 准备工作 在微信公众平台(https://mp.weixin.qq.com/)注册账号获APPID 下载微信开发者工具 (https://developers.weixin.qq.com/miniprogram/dev/devtools/download.html) 在小程序文档中找到API下的设备下的扫码API(https://developers.weixin.qq.com…

Java生成微信小程序二维码,5种实现方式,一个比一个简单

文章目录 前言先看官网一、JDK自带的URLConnection方式二、Apache的HttpClient方式三、okhttp3方式四、Unirest方式五、RestTemplate方式其它细节getAccessToken构建参数mapbyte[]数组 源码下载 前言 先介绍一下项目场景&#xff0c;主要是通过微信小程序二维码裂变分享&#…

微信小程序转二维码方法分享

微信小程序转二维码方法分享 需要转码的可以看看 这个东西是看个人需求的&#xff0c;618就要来了&#xff0c;各种活动也将来袭 有些小伙伴不知道怎么生成 为了方便小程序邀请活动没法外发&#xff0c;这里分享下将小程序转二维码的方法 首先&#xff0c;你需要在电脑上打…

微信小程序绘制二维码

一、前言 在日常的小程序项目中&#xff0c;会经常遇到需要动态绘制二维码的需求。使用场景很多&#xff0c;例如绘制在海报上&#xff0c;例如制作票务码、核销码等等。 这篇文章是应一位好友的需求而写的&#xff0c;也希望能够给有需要的同学一些帮助。 二、实现原理 使用…

微信小程序二维码识别

目前市场上二维码识别的软件或者网站越来越多&#xff0c;可是真正方便&#xff0c;无广告的却少之很少。 于是&#xff0c;自己突发奇想做了一个微信二维码识别的小程序。 包含功能&#xff1a; 1、识别二维码 ①普通二维码 ②条形码 ③只是复制解析出来的数据 2、生成二维码 …